A payments testing platform used by banks and fintechs, lifted from a 2000s desktop app into a responsive web product.

© PaySim

Challenge

PaySim is the default standard for eftpos testing in Australia, and it still ran as a Windows desktop app from the 2000s. Modernising it could not come at the cost of the workflows power users rely on daily.

Solution

I mapped every existing flow input by input and counted the clicks each took, so improvement could be measured rather than assumed. The redesign leads with new users through clearer grouping, while power users keep familiar page locations and keyboard shortcuts.

Outcomes

A noticeable increase in new users since the redesign went live, without power users losing the speed they had in the desktop tool.
